Areas to Consider


1. Customer Service Enhancement

Chatbots and Virtual Assistants: Deploy AI-driven chatbots to handle routine inquiries, provide 24/7 support, and reduce wait times. Sentiment Analysis: Use AI to analyze customer feedback and sentiment from various channels to improve services.

2. Fraud Detection and Prevention

Real-Time Monitoring: Implement AI algorithms to detect and flag unusual transactions in real-time. Predictive Analytics: Use machine learning models to predict potential fraud based on historical data and behavioural patterns.

3. Loan Processing Automation

Credit Scoring: AI can evaluate creditworthiness more accurately by analyzing a wider range of data points. Document Verification: Automate the verification of documents submitted for loan applications, speeding up the approval process.

4. Personalized Banking Services

Customer Insights: Leverage AI to gain insights into customer behaviour and preferences, allowing for personalized product recommendations. Marketing Campaigns: Use AI to target customers with tailored marketing campaigns based on their transaction history and preferences.

5. Risk Management

Risk Assessment: AI can analyze market trends and economic indicators to provide early warnings about potential risks. Compliance Monitoring: Automate compliance checks and monitoring to ensure adherence to regulations and reduce the risk of non-compliance penalties.

6. Operational Efficiency

Process Automation: Use robotic process automation (RPA) to handle repetitive tasks such as data entry, account reconciliation, and report generation. Workflow Optimization: AI can optimize workflows by identifying bottlenecks and suggesting improvements.

Implementation Strategy

Assessment: Evaluate the current state of digital banking operations and identify areas where AI can add value. Pilot Projects: Start with pilot projects to test AI applications in a controlled environment. Scalability: Ensure that AI solutions are scalable and can handle increasing volumes of data and transactions. Employee Training: Train staff on AI tools and their applications to ensure seamless integration. Continuous Improvement: Regularly update AI models and algorithms based on new data and evolving business needs.

Challenges and Considerations

Data Quality: Ensure high-quality data for accurate AI predictions and analysis. Regulatory Compliance: Stay compliant with financial regulations while implementing AI solutions. Customer Trust: Maintain transparency in AI-driven decisions to build and maintain customer trust. Integration: Seamlessly integrate AI with existing banking systems and processes.
